    The best thing to do is ask for the name of the consultant you were referred to. Get the number of the hospital/clinic/secretary and ring yourself to check whether they got your letter and when your appointment will be. I usually warn people that it takes up to four weeks to get an appointment letter. If they don't, then they have to check. By the way the appointment letter mostly only goes to the patient, though one of the exceptions may be psychiatry.
